Bolton Wanderers remain confident of closing a double £5 million signing for Real Madrid pair Marcos Alonso and Rodrigo Moreno.
The Bolton News says reports from Lisbon claim Benfica are still very much in the hunt for the Spain Under-21 internationals, and are willing to match asking price for the pair who both forced their way on to the bench last season under former Real manager Manuel Pellegrini. He has since been replaced by Jose Mourinho.
But the lure of regular football in England appears to have given Wanderers the edge in what is likely to be Owen Coyle's first cash signing since taking over at the Reebok.
Chairman Phil Gartside has already met with sporting director Jorge Valdano at the Bernabeu and hopes to resume negotiations early next week.
